Toddlers typically learn to spit out toothpaste around the age of 2 or 3, when they have developed the necessary motor skills and understanding to do so.

How is toothpaste used in space?

In space, astronauts use toothpaste similarly to how they do on Earth, applying it to a toothbrush. However, due to the lack of gravity, they must be careful to avoid swallowing the toothpaste or allowing it to float away. To mitigate this, astronauts often use a small amount of water to rinse, and special containers help keep the toothpaste and toothbrush secure during use. After brushing, they typically spit the residue into a specially designed waste container.


Can you brush your cats teeth with regular toothpaste?

No, you should never use human toothpaste on a cat, as the fluoride alone is toxic and can make a cat ill if ingested. If you wish to brush your cat's teeth, use a pet toothpaste that has no fluoride in and is safe to ingest (I cat cannot spit out toothpaste like humans do).
